Abstract

Simulium oblongum sp. nov. is described based on female, male, pupal and larval specimens collected in Thailand. This new species is characterized by the genitalia of both sexes, especially the elongated cercus in the female and the absence of parameral hooks in the male; the pupal gill with a dendroid type of 31-33 slender filaments; the larval antenna subequal in length to the stem of the labral fan. Based on a combination of these distinctive characteristics observed in this new species, a new subgenus, Asiosimulium, is proposed within the genus Simulium s. l.
